The WB 100+ Station Group

The WB 100+ Station Group (originally called The WeB in its developmental stages) was a group of primarily non-broadcast local cable television outlets carrying programming from The WB Television Network, along with syndicated programming outside of network programming time periods; the service was intended for areas ranked below the top 100 television media markets in the United States.
